Territorial Defense Mechanisms and Ritualized Aggression
Territorial defense in robins is a fascinating display of avian behavior, encompassing a range of tactics from subtle displays of dominance to outright physical confrontations. While direct combat is often avoided, male robins frequently engage in ritualized aggression, which serves as a means of establishing and maintaining territorial boundaries. This may involve elaborate song displays, wing-fluttering, and threat postures, all designed to intimidate rivals and signal a willingness to defend their claimed space. The intensity of these displays is often correlated with the perceived value of the territory, with prime breeding locations eliciting more vigorous defense effort.
The Role of Song in Territory Establishment
The robin's song is perhaps its most recognizable characteristic, and it plays a central role in territorial communication. Male robins utilize a complex repertoire of songs to advertise their presence, delineate their territory, and attract potential mates. The frequency, duration, and complexity of these songs can all convey information about the singer's quality and dominance. Variations in song can also signal subtle shifts in territorial boundaries or warn off intruders. Furthermore, robins learn song variations from their fathers and other nearby males, creating localized ‘dialects’ that reinforce territorial recognition within a community. Understanding these nuances offers insight into the social complexities present within a robin population.

Factors Influencing Territory Size and Quality
The size and quality of a robin’s territory are not predetermined; they are fluid characteristics influenced by a variety of ecological and social factors. Areas with abundant food sources, suitable nesting sites, and ample cover tend to be highly coveted, leading to smaller and more fiercely defended territories. Conversely, in resource-poor environments, territories may be larger and less clearly defined. Population density plays a significant role as well, with higher densities often resulting in smaller territories due to increased competition. The overall health and condition of a male robin also influences his ability to secure and defend a prime location.

The Role of Age and Experience in Territoriality
A robin’s experience greatly influences its ability to establish and maintain a territory. Young, inexperienced males often struggle to compete with older, more established individuals, frequently being forced to settle for less desirable territories or delaying breeding altogether. As robins mature, they gain valuable knowledge about resource availability, competitor behaviors, and the optimal strategies for territorial defense. This learning process is crucial for their reproductive success. Older males typically exhibit more consistent and effective territorial defenses, demonstrating a superior understanding of the challenges and opportunities within their environment.

Impact of Climate Change on Robin Territories
Climate change is rapidly altering ecosystems worldwide, and robins, like many other bird species, face significant challenges as a result. Shifts in temperature and precipitation patterns can disrupt the timing of breeding seasons, alter the availability of food resources, and increase the frequency of extreme weather events. These changes can lead to mismatches between robin breeding cycles and peak food availability, reducing reproductive success. Furthermore, altered habitat conditions can force robins to abandon traditional territories and seek out new, potentially less suitable locations. This disruption can have cascading effects on population dynamics and territorial structures.
